Privacy model
Dictovo is designed for people and companies who cannot treat voice data as disposable cloud traffic. In the current Mac app, your speech and dictated text never leave your Mac. Language files come in; your content does not go out.
Audio is recorded in memory, transcribed locally on Apple Silicon, and discarded. There is no telemetry, analytics, or crash reporting in the Mac app.
After the first language download, dictation keeps working offline. Extra world languages download local language files once when you choose them.
Transcripts, dictionary entries, and history stay local to the user or business. Optional license checks do not include audio or dictated text.
Security-minded design
Dictovo is designed with NIS2, ISO 27001 and EU Cyber Resilience Act principles in mind: local processing, minimal data sharing, controlled updates, license visibility, and user-owned data. This is not a certification claim; it is the product direction behind the architecture.
For MKB teams this means less voice data exposure, a clearer vendor boundary, and a workflow that is easier to explain to security, finance, legal, HR, and operations stakeholders.
How it works
Dictovo sits in the background and types into the app you are already using. Email, ChatGPT, Notion, Slack, Word, browser fields: Dictovo inserts text. Optional local text tools can clean up, translate, or transform selected text when you explicitly trigger them; Dictovo does not click, send, or navigate for you.
Hold your shortcut for push-to-talk, or double-tap for handsfree dictation.
Supported languages are processed on your Mac. Extra world languages are enabled after a one-time local language download.
Text is inserted into the active field. Optional cleanup, translation, and selected-text transforms are advanced features where supported.
